class ConfigScript:
    def __init__(self):
        self.defines = []
        self.includefiles = []
        self.libraries = []

    def unlink(self, filename):
        try:
            os.unlink(filename)
        except OSError: 
            pass

    def test_code(self, head, body, stdh=1):
        fi = open("setup_test.c", "wb")
        if stdh:
            fi.write("#include <stdlib.h>\n")
            fi.write("#include <stdio.h>\n")
            for i in self.includefiles:
                fi.write("#include <%s>\n" % i)
        for d in self.defines:
            fi.write("%s;\n" % d)
        fi.write(head)
        fi.write("\nint main()\n")
        fi.write("{\n")
        fi.write(body)
        fi.write("\n}\n")
        fi.close()
        #fi = open("setup_test.c", "rb")
        #print fi.read()
        #fi.close()

        quiet = 1
        if quiet:
            try:
                # redirect stderr
                sys.stderr.flush()
                err = open('/dev/null', 'a+', 0)
                olderr = open('/dev/null', 'a+', 0)
                os.dup2(2, olderr.fileno())
                os.dup2(err.fileno(), 2)
            except:
                pass

        error = 0
        try:
            cc.compile(["setup_test.c"], include_dirs=cc.include_dirs)
        except CompileError:
            error = 1

        if quiet:
            try:
                # unredirect stderr
                sys.stderr.flush()
                err = open('/dev/null', 'a+', 0)
                os.dup2(olderr.fileno(), 2)
                olderr.close()
                err.close()
            except:
                pass

        self.unlink("setup_test.o")
        self.unlink("setup_test.obj")
        self.unlink("setup_test.c")
        if error:
            return None
        else:
            return 1

    def system_has_property(self,name):
        if name.startswith("STD"):
            return 1
        elif name.startswith("INTERNAL"):
            return 1
        elif name == "PACKAGE":
            return "\"swftools\""
        elif name == "VERSION":
            fi = open("configure.in", "rb")
            for line in fi.readlines():
                if line.startswith("VERSION="):
                    return '"'+line[8:].strip()+'"'
            return "unknown"
        elif "POPPLER" in name:
            return None
        elif name.startswith("HAVE_") and name.endswith("_H"):
            header = name[5:].lower()
            c = header.rfind("_")
            if c>=0:
                header = header[0:c]+"."+header[c+1]
            header = header.replace("_","/")
            ok = 0
            for dir in cc.include_dirs:
                if os.path.isfile(os.path.join(dir,header)):
                    ok = 1
                    break
            if ok and self.test_code("#include <"+header+">", ""):
                if header.startswith("sys"):
                    self.includefiles += [header]
                return 1
        elif name.startswith("HAVE_LIB") \
          or name.startswith("HAVE_FONTCONFIG") \
          or name.startswith("HAVE_FREETYPE"):
            if name.startswith("HAVE_LIB"):
                libname = name[8:].lower()
            else:
                libname = name[5:].lower()
            if cc.find_library_file(cc.library_dirs, libname):
                update_list(self.libraries, [libname])
                return 1
        elif name.startswith("HAVE_LAME"):
            return None
        elif name.startswith("HAVE_FFTW3"):
            return None
        elif name.startswith("O_BINARY"):
            if sys.platform.startswith("win"):
                return None
            else:
                return 0
        elif name == "boolean":
            if self.test_code("", "boolean b;"):
                return None
            else:
                self.defines += ["typedef int boolean"]
                return "int"
        elif name.startswith("SIZEOF_"):
            t = name[7:].lower().replace("_", " ")
            if t == "voidp":
                t = "void*"
            for i in [1,2,4,8]:
                s = "static int test_array [%d+1-sizeof(%s)*2];\ntest_array [0] = 0;" % (i*2,t)
                if self.test_code("", s):
                    return i
            return None
        elif name.startswith("USE_FREEETYPE"):
            # TODO: run a test here?
            return 1 
        elif name.startswith("HAVE_"):
            function = name[5:].lower()
            params=""
            if function=="bcopy":
                params = "0,0,0"
            elif function=="bzero":
                params = "0,0"
            return self.test_code("", "%s(%s);" % (function,params), stdh=0)
        return None

    def create_config(self):
        print "Creating config.h..."

        fi = open("config.h.in", "rb")
        fo = open("config.h", "wb")
        for line in fi.readlines():
            if line.startswith("#undef "):
                line = line.strip()
                name = line[7:]
                if " " in name:
                    name = name.split(" ")[0]
                value = self.system_has_property(name)
                if value is None:
                    fo.write("// %s is not set\n" % (name))
                else:
                    fo.write("#define %s %s\n" % (name, value))
            else:
                fo.write(line)
        fo.write("// python:lib "+(" ".join(self.libraries))+"\n")
        fo.close()
        fi.close()

    def load(self):
        if not os.path.isfile("config.h"):
            return 0
        fi = open("config.h", "rb")
        for line in fi.readlines():
            if line.startswith("// python: lib "):
                self.libraries = line[15:].split(" ")
        fi.close()
        return
